8th grade Olympic students can be admitted to high school without taking the National Assessment exam.

According to a Ministerial Order, students who have won prizes in national or international school Olympiads can be admitted to high school without taking the National Assessment. The Order approves a list of 52 national and 23 international school olympiads, whose prizes can be equated with a place in ninth grade without the National Assessment exam. This also applies to enrolment in national military colleges.
